WebJan 23, 2024 · Figure: Design and principle of a thermos (vacuum flask), how does work. The first and simplest measure to reduce heat loss, is aimed at the heat transfer by thermal convection. A simple screw cap prevents the hot steam from escaping and ensures that no heat is transferred by convection to the environment. The second measure serves to limit ... WebSep 27, 2024 · A thermos is a container that is used to keep items hot or cold over a period of time. A simple thermos consists of a container surrounded with material that is a good thermal insulator. A unique way of keeping material at its original temperature is to use a vacuum as an insulator.
